Ever wondered what would have happened if Thelma and Louise had abandoned their original plan and decided to elope instead? Well, thanks to the brilliant minds at Tropic of Flowers and the keen eye of Anais Possamai Photography, we don’t have to wonder anymore! This same-sex elopement inspiration took place in the wild desert terrains of Joshua Tree and Palm Springs and featured an earthy color palette with pops of coral that perfectly matched the overall retro vibe. Between the outfit changes that took the couple from t-shirts and jeans to vintage ensembles to southwest-meets-boho wedding attire, the vintage Thunderbird, and the intimate sweetheart table setup, every single detail of this styled shoot made our hearts skip a beat.
